Most Wickets in Asia Cup History | Asia Cup 2023

Bangladesh's allrounder Shakib Al Hasan so far played 13 Asia Cup matches. He took 19 wicktes and his best was 4/42.

Image: Getty Images

10. Shakib Al Hasan:

Indian allrounder Ravindra Jadeja  played 14 Asia Cup matches. He took 19 wickets with 4/29 as his best.

Image: Getty Images

9. Ravindra Jadeja:

Bangladesh's spinner Abdur Razzak ranks 8th in the list. He played 18 Asia Cup matches and took 22 wickets.

Image: Getty Images

8. Abdur Razzak:

Sri Lankan legend and former captain comes at No.7. He took 22 wickets in 25 Asia Cup matches.

Image: Getty Images

7. Sanath Jayasuriya

Former Indian player Irfan Pathan ranks at No.6. He took 22 wickets in 12 Asia Cup matches.

Image: Getty Images

6. Irfan Pathan:

Former Sri Lankan pacer Chaminda Vaas comes at No.5. He took 23 wickets in 19 Asia Cup matches.

Image: Getty Images

5. Chaminda Vaas:

Former Pakistan spin bowler Saeed Ajmal ranks No.4 on the list. He took 25 wickets in 12 Asia Cup matches.

Image: Getty Images

4. Saeed Ajmal:

No.3 position is secured by former Sri Lankan bowler Ajantha Mendis. He took 26 wickets in only 8 Asia Cup matches.

Image: Getty Images

3. Ajantha Mendis: 

Sri Lankan legend Lasith Malinga comes at No.2 on the list. He took 29 wickets in 14 Asia Cup matches.

Image: Getty Images

2. Lasith Malinga:

Top spot on the list is grabbed by Sri Lankan legend Muthiah Muralidaran. He took 30 wickets in 24 Asia Cup matches.
